The Ministry of Justice is seeking a committed and professional individual to join the Taunton Probation Office as an Administrative Support Probation Officer.
This position is central to the smooth and safe running of our office. You will be the first point of contact for visitors, staff, and partner agencies, helping to create a supportive environment for rehabilitation and public protection.
Key Responsibilities
Front of House & Safety Support
- Welcoming and granting access to visitors, service users and contractors.
- Maintaining awareness of behaviour and body language to identify risks.
- Reporting health & safety issues promptly and appropriately.
Communication & Public Interaction
- Answering incoming phone calls and providing clear, professional responses.
- Liaising with probation officers, partner organisations and external agencies.
- Supporting members of the public with confidence and professionalism.
Administrative & Office Duties
- Completing accurate data input and maintaining internal systems.
- Handling petty cash and issuing passes or rail tickets.
- Managing general administrative tasks and reception duties.
- Providing late night office cover twice weekly.
